Background:Xuanwei City is a region with highest lung cancer mortality in China.Previous studies have shown that indoor air pollution is the main reason for the high lung cancer mortality in Xuanwei City.Therefore,in the 1980s,the local government conducted the stove improvement project.Over time,the lagging effect of indoor air pollution gradually weakened,and the effect of smoking may be prominent.Our aim is to estimate the smoking-related disease burden and the disease burden in male attributable to smoking in Xuanwei City from 1990 to 2016 and thus provide evidence for government health policy decisions.And to explore the methodology of population attributable fractions estimation due to smoking.Method:Mortality data were from the 2nd&3rd National Retrospective Cause of Death Survey and Xuanwei Disease Surveillance Point System from 2011 onwards.Mortality rates and years of life lost(YLLs)for 17 smoking-related diseases were calculated by four time period,1990-92,2004-05,2011-13 and 2014-16.In order to get the disability-adjusted life-years(DALYs)of lung cancer in 2014-16,mortality-to-prevalence ratio(M/P)of lung cancer calculated from six towns of Xuanwei were adjusted by DisMod Ⅱ,then prevalence for other towns based on M/P were estimated.Two indirect methods for population attributable fractions(PAF)due to smoking,prevalence-based and smoking impact ratio-based(SIR),were compared.At last,the PAF calculation method from Global Burden of Diseases,Injuries,and Risk Factors Study(GBD)2015,which combined the above two methods,was used to estimate smoking-attributable disease burden among males in Xuanwei.Result:In 2014-16,the mortality rates of cardiovascular diseases,respiratory diseases and malignant tumors in Xuanwei City were 160.08,148.38 and 145.87 per 100000,respectively.Accordingly,YLLs were 45.0,33.6 and 60.8 thousand person-years,respectively.Since 1990,the death rates of cardiovascular diseases have shown a continuous upward trend,while respiratory diseases has shown downward trend.Except for cervical cancer,the mortality rate of various cancers mostly increased first,and began to decline after 2005.The trend of YLL rate is similar to the mortality rate.The prevalence of lung cancer in Xuanwei City in 2014-16 was 322.98 per100000.The average annual lung cancer YLLs and YLDs were 38.7 and 0.08 thousand person-years,respectively.The PAFs caused by smoking by the direct method,SIR-based method,and prevalence-based method for male lung cancer were 64.32%,61.98%,and 51.44%respectively.In 2014-16,in total,the male PAF caused by smoking in Xuanwei City was 24.36%,which caused 1482 deaths and 29.3 thousand person-years of lost.Smoking-attributable deaths due to lung cancer and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ease(COPD)were the highest,567(38.24%)and 661(44.59%),respectively.Conclusion:In general,the male smoking PAF in Xuanwei City was higher than the national level,although the above results have certain limitations,we didn’t consider the competitive effect of indoor air pollution in smoking-attributable disease burden.However,the above results suggest that the local government should actively carry out tobacco control and accelerate the tobacco control legislation.SIR-based PAF is slightly higher than prevalence-based PAF in Xuanwei,further research should be conducted to explore the PAF calculation method. |
